Operation

 

1. General 

ECS-10HT1  could  be  specially  used  in  kitchen  cabinet  and  air  curtain  cabinet,    unit  Celsius  and 

Fahrenheit  could  be  switched  by  menu,  Max.  two  channel  of  sensors  separately  used  for  cabinet 

temperature  adjustment  and  defrost  control;  Compressor  and  defroster  relay  could  select  the 

specification  30A-10A,  or  17A-10A;  The  display  of  the  controller  could  be  selected  as  cabinet 

temperature  or  evaporator  temperature;  split  design  between  control  board  and  display  panel,  very 

convenient for repairing and replacement.

Note: Defrost or lighting relay could be used as lighting relay or defrost relay. 

When parameter U3=0, defrost/lighting relay is used as defrost output, and it has no function of lighting 

control at this time; 

When parameter U3=1,  defrost/lighting relay is used as lighting output, and it has no defrost function, 

defrost is proceeded as off-cycle defrost.
